Commit deff2ec5 authored by 位宇华's avatar 位宇华

中浩工资--代码提交

parent 26c6ab0e
...@@ -57,9 +57,9 @@ public class CurrentRuleSalarySupport { ...@@ -57,9 +57,9 @@ public class CurrentRuleSalarySupport {
String mineCode = newRuleRequestModelList.get(0).getMineid(); String mineCode = newRuleRequestModelList.get(0).getMineid();
ReplaceSpace(newRuleRequestModelList); ReplaceSpace(newRuleRequestModelList);
List<SalaryExpenseSourceModel> sourceModels = salaryMapper.getSources(mineCode); List<SalaryExpenseSourceModel> sourceModels = salaryMapper.getSources(mineCode);
newRuleRequestModelList=newRuleRequestModelList.stream().filter(v->sourceModels.stream().anyMatch(source->StringUtils.equals(v.getRow(),source.getOrg()))).collect(Collectors.toList()); newRuleRequestModelList = newRuleRequestModelList.stream().filter(v -> sourceModels.stream().anyMatch(source -> StringUtils.equals(v.getRow(), source.getOrg()))).collect(Collectors.toList());
List<SalaryExcelModel> salaryExcelModelList = getSalaryMapping(newRuleRequestModelList); List<SalaryExcelModel> salaryExcelModelList = getSalaryMapping(newRuleRequestModelList);
salaryExcelModelList.forEach(v->v.setSumSalary(new BigDecimal(v.getSumSalary()).toPlainString())); salaryExcelModelList.forEach(v -> v.setSumSalary(new BigDecimal(v.getSumSalary()).toPlainString()));
return salaryExcelModelList; return salaryExcelModelList;
} }
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ment